GY-NEO6MV2 module series is a family of stand-alone GPS receivers featuring the high-performance ublox 6 positioning engine. The module simply checks its location on earth and provides output data which is the longitude and latitude of its position. GY-NEO6MV2 comes with a small battery for hot-start, along with a built-in EEPROM. To offer better signal reception, there is an external ceramic antenna that connects to the board via a U.FL connector
GY-NEO6MV2 GPS module can track up to 22 satellites over 50 channels and achieve the industry’s highest level of tracking sensitivity i.e. -161 dB while consuming only 45 mA current. Its compact architecture, modular design, power, and memory options make NEO6MV2 modules ideal for battery-operated mobile devices with very strict cost and space constraints.

GY-NEO6MV2 Key Features
- Based on u-Blox NEO-6M GPS module with onboard backup battery and built-in EEPROM.
- Comes with an external U.FL ceramic antenna for better reception.
- It is compatible with various flight controller boards designed to work with a GPS module, APM2.0, and APM2.5 just to name a few.
- This module has a built-in voltage regulator and it is sometimes referred to as GY-GPS6MV2.
- Navigate down to –162 dBm and –148 dBm cold start
- EEPROM to save configuration settings
- Faster acquisition with AssistNow Autonomous
- Configurable power management
- Hybrid GPS/SBAS engine (WAAS, EGNOS, MSAS)
- Standalone GPS receiver
- Anti-jamming technology
- Compatible with u-Blox GPS Solution for Android
- A-GPS: AssistNow Online and AssistNow Offline services OMA SUPL compliant
- Under 1 second time-to-first-fix for hot and aided starts
- Time-To-First-fix: For Cold Start 32s, For Warm Start 23s, For Hot Start <1s
- UART Interface at the output pins (Can use SPI, I2C, and USB by soldering pins to the chip core)
GY-NEO6MV2 Pinout

Pin Name | Pin No. | Description |
---|---|---|
Vcc | 1 | Chip Supply Voltage |
RX | 2 | UART receive pin |
TX | 3 | UART transmit pin |
GND | 4 | Ground pin |
NEO6MV2 Specifications
- Operating voltage: 3.3V to 5VDC.
- Communication interface: UART TTL, 9600bps.
- LED signal indicator.
- Pin-out for power and interface
- Operating Current: 45mA
- TXD/RXD Impedance: 510Ω
- Navigation Sensitivity : -161dBm
- Capture Time: Cool start (27sec), Hot start (1sec)
- Communication Protocol: NMEA, UBX Binary, RTCM
- Serial Baud Rate: 4800-230400 (default 9600)
- Operating Temperature -40°C ~ 85°C
- Type: 50 channels, GPS L1(1575.42Mhz)
- Horizontal Position Accuracy: 2.5m
- Navigation Update Rate: 1HZ (5Hz maximum)
- Dimension: 36 x 26 mm.
- Weight: 22g.
Applications GY-NEO6MV2
- GPS Navigation Systems
- Aircraft Positioning
Datasheet GY-NEO6MV2
You can download the datasheet for the GY-NEO6MV2 Flight Control GPS Module by clicking the link given below:
See Also: CD4059 Program Divide-by-N Counter | YX5300 MP3 Music Player UART Control Serial Module | 16×2 LCD Character Display Module